Job Description
Under direction from the Cosmetics Selling Manager, the Beauty Advisor is responsible for providing outstanding customer service, building individual and vendor line sales volumes, establishing and maintaining customer relationships, working effectively with other team members, and establishing new Saks Fifth Avenue accounts while demonstrating consistent adherence to company standards and procedures. The Beauty Advisor will also focus on in‑house training programs, pre‑booked facial consultation events, and maintaining a properly merchandised counter while proficiently closing the retail sale.
Utilizing Saks Fifth Avenue's clienteling system, the Beauty Advisor is responsible for driving their own business and creating their own success.
